About Fernanda Amicarelli
Fernanda Amicarelli is a scholar working on Molecular Biology, Physiology, Cell Biology, Genetics and Pediatrics, Perinatology and Child Health, having authored 103 papers that have together received 4.5k indexed citations. Recurring topics across this work include Glutathione Transferases and Polymorphisms (12 papers), melanin and skin pigmentation (11 papers), Adipose Tissue and Metabolism (11 papers), Biochemical effects in animals (10 papers), Genomics, phytochemicals, and oxidative stress (10 papers), Advanced Glycation End Products research (10 papers), Electromagnetic Fields and Biological Effects (10 papers) and Reproductive Biology and Fertility (8 papers). The work is most often cited by research in Aging (187 citations), Geriatrics and Gerontology (294 citations), Reproductive Medicine (603 citations), Biophysics (445 citations) and Clinical Biochemistry (359 citations). Fernanda Amicarelli has collaborated with scholars based in Italy, United States and South Korea. Frequent co-authors include Carla Tatone, Stefano Falone, Giovanna Di Emidio, Valentina Caracciolo, Mahmut Mijit, Silvia Di Loreto, Antonio Giordano, M. C. Carbone, Anna Maria D’Alessandro and Carmine Di Ilio. Their work appears in journals such as The International Journal of Biochemistry & Cell Biology, Oxidative Medicine and Cellular Longevity, Journal of Cellular Physiology, Scientific Reports and Advances in experimental medicine and biology.
